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ing Market Overview

The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ing Market is valued at USD 12 million, based on a five-year historical analysis and its share within the global distributed acoustic sensing market, which is estimated in the mid hundreds of millions in recent years.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for real-time monitoring solutions in sectors such as oil and gas, transportation, and security, where distributed acoustic sensing is used for well and reservoir monitoring, pipeline leak detection, perimeter security, and infrastructure condition assessment. The rising need for enhanced safety, operational efficiency, and predictive maintenance in critical infrastructure has further supported the adoption of distributed acoustic sensing technologies across Bahrain and the wider Gulf region. Key demand drivers in this market are Bahrain’s role as a regional hub for oil and gas activities within the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) and the broader GCC investment in fiber-based monitoring for energy, utilities, and transportation infrastructure. Bahrain’s strategic location, developed telecom and fiber backbone, and continued investment in digital oilfield technologies and smart infrastructure projects support the deployment of distributed acoustic sensing in upstream operations, pipelines, power cables, and transport corridors. The country’s broader economic diversification agenda, including expansion of downstream petrochemicals and logistics, is also stimulating demand for advanced monitoring and security solutions that leverage distributed acoustic sensing. In 2023, Bahrain’s government continued to strengthen the regulatory and operational framework for oil and gas pipeline and facility safety under instruments such as the Technical Regulation for the Safety of Oil and Gas Pipelines issued by the National Oil and Gas Authority (NOGA) and implemented through the Ministry of Oil and Environment, which set requirements for continuous integrity management, leak detection, and emergency preparedness for transmission infrastructure. These measures encourage the use of advanced monitoring technologies, including fiber?optic based leak detection and distributed sensing, to reduce environmental risks, limit hydrocarbon losses, and improve incident response times across the energy value chain.

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ing Market Segmentation

By Component: The components of the market include hardware, software, and services, consistent with global distributed acoustic sensing value chain structures. Hardware encompasses interrogator units, sensing cables, and connectivity solutions, which are essential for the deployment of distributed acoustic sensing systems and typically represent the largest share of solution costs. Software includes analytics, visualization, and AI/ML tools that enhance data interpretation, pattern recognition, and decision?making for applications such as intrusion detection, leak localization, and vibration analysis. Services cover integration, commissioning, maintenance, and managed monitoring, ensuring the effective operation of the systems and enabling end users to outsource continuous data analysis and alarm management where in?house expertise is limited. By Fiber Type: The market is segmented into single-mode fiber and multi-mode fiber, in line with common distributed acoustic sensing deployments globally. Single-mode fiber is preferred for long-distance, high?sensitivity applications such as cross?country pipelines, power transmission corridors, and offshore umbilicals due to its low attenuation, long sensing range (tens of kilometers), and high bandwidth capabilities. Multi?mode fiber, while suitable for shorter distances, is often used in applications where cost is a significant factor and where existing legacy fiber is available, such as in plant perimeters, shorter gathering lines, or facility?level monitoring. The choice between these fiber types depends on the specific requirements of the deployment environment, including required sensing distance, spatial resolution, existing fiber infrastructure, and project budget.

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

Increasing Demand for Real-Time Monitoring: The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ing market is experiencing a surge in demand for real-time monitoring solutions, particularly in sectors like oil and gas. In future, the oil and gas sector in Bahrain is projected to contribute approximately $14 billion to the economy, driving the need for advanced monitoring technologies. This demand is fueled by the necessity for immediate data acquisition to enhance operational efficiency and safety, particularly in critical infrastructure. Advancements in Fiber Optic Technology: The evolution of fiber optic technology is a significant growth driver for the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ing market. In future, the fiber optic cable market in the Middle East is expected to reach $1.8 billion, reflecting a compound growth rate of 12% annually. These advancements enable more efficient data transmission and improved sensing capabilities, making them essential for industries requiring high-resolution monitoring and analysis, such as telecommunications and environmental monitoring. Rising Investments in Infrastructure Development: Bahrain's government is heavily investing in infrastructure development, with a projected $4 billion allocated for various projects in future. This investment is expected to enhance the demand for Distributed Acoustic Sensing technologies, particularly in monitoring the structural integrity of new constructions. The focus on smart city initiatives further amplifies the need for innovative monitoring solutions, positioning the market for substantial growth in the coming years.

Market Challenges

High Initial Investment Costs: One of the primary challenges facing the Bahrain Distributed Acoustic Sensing market is the high initial investment required for technology deployment. The average cost of implementing a Distributed Acoustic Sensing system can exceed $1.2 million, which poses a barrier for smaller companies and startups. This financial hurdle can limit market penetration and slow the adoption of these advanced monitoring solutions across various sectors. Limited Awareness Among Potential Users: There is a significant knowledge gap regarding Distributed Acoustic Sensing technologies among potential users in Bahrain. A future survey indicated that over 65% of industry stakeholders are unaware of the benefits and applications of these systems. This lack of awareness can hinder market growth, as companies may opt for traditional monitoring methods that they are more familiar with, despite the advantages offered by Distributed Acoustic Sensing.
